    Are there theme nights for June 17 Cruise on Disney wonder to Alaska? Is there laundry available on Disney wonder?

    The Freezing the Night Away deck party is currently scheduled for Night 5 of your Disney Wonder cruise, and it sounds like it will melt any frozen heart! Entertainment, including deck party times and days, are subject to change, so be sure to download the Disney Cruise Line Navigator App before setting sail. The App is the perfect place to find character meet and greets, your rotational dining location for the evening, and entertainment while onboard. I like to search the app for activities I might be interested in and have the app notify me when it is time for the activities to start by favoriting/hearting them.

    Jennifer, I also have great news: Laundry service is available on all Disney Cruise Line ships. Whether you would like self-service laundry or full-service laundry and dry-cleaning services to pick up and deliver to your stateroom, there is an option for everyone. You can find self-service laundry on Decks 2, 6, and 7 on the Disney Wonder. Everything you need is onboard! Use your Key to the World card to operate washers and dryers (for a nominal fee), and there are detergent and dryer sheets for purchase - no need to bring anything from home (unless you want to, of course!). If you choose to use full-service laundry charges will be applied to your stateroom folio. There is even an option for express service, should you need it!
